London: London Centre of Arab Studies, 1998. 1st edition. Hardcover. Fine cloth copy in a very good, slightly edge-nicked and dust-dulled dust-wrapper, now mylar-sleeved. Remains particularly well-preserved overall; tight, bright, clean and strong. Physical description: 128 pages: illustrations, map, portraits; 24 x 29 cm.Notes: Includes bibliographical references (p. 125-127) and index.Subjects: Photography Kuwait History. Kuwait History 20th century; Pictorial works. Kuwait Civilization; Pictorial works.Kuwait Social conditions; Pictorial works. Kuwait Social life and customs; Pictorial works. Kuwait Description and travelOther names: Grant, Gillian.London Centre of Arab Studies. Genre: Bibliography. Illustrated.
